O'Neill has - almost always in association with others - produced some fairly good papers on dog health in the past for the RVC. In this case, the study was funded from our Kennel Club's Charitable Trust. And while both O'Neill and the KC deny that the money means they ever influence the outcome of such studies, I can't help but get the impression here that he was at pains not to 'conclude' anything that would directly fly in the face of the KC's current position on the GSD in the UK.

The sub-text is that we are dubbed a 'Category 3 breed'; and despite, as far as I can see, fulfilling, as a breed, the requirements for being upgraded to Category 2, we seem to be in the Catch 22 position that we cannot satisfy the KC we are doing everything they want until there is not another cow-hocked or hinged backed dog in the country. Notwithstanding that the breeders cannot much influence two thirds of UK GSDs since they remain unregistered, as pointed out in my earlier post.
